Steam vs. Epic Games: Which Platform is Best for Competitive Online Gaming?

The Battle of Gaming Platforms

In the realm of online competitive gaming, two giants stand out: Steam and Epic Games. Both platforms have gained massive popularity, attracting millions of users with their diverse game libraries and unique features. In this article, we will explore the key differences between these platforms and determine which is better suited for esports enthusiasts.

Game Libraries and Exclusive Titles

Steam has long been the go-to platform for PC gamers, boasting an extensive library that includes a wide range of genres from indie hits to triple-A titles. Titles like Counter-Strike: Global Offensive and Dota 2 have become staples in the esports community, thanks to their competitive gameplay and vibrant scenes. On the other hand, Epic Games has gained traction with its exclusive titles, most notably Fortnite, which has become a cultural phenomenon and an esports powerhouse.

User Experience and Accessibility

Both platforms offer a user-friendly experience, but they do have their nuances. Steam’s interface is well-established, providing users with comprehensive tools for managing their game libraries, including community features and mod support. Epic Games, however, has streamlined its interface, focusing on simplicity and easy navigation, which appeals to new users. Both platforms support easy game downloads, but Epic's frequent free game offerings attract players looking for value.

Competitive Features and Support

When it comes to competitive gaming, both Steam and Epic Games have made significant strides. Steam's robust matchmaking system and integration of tournaments through platforms like ESL and DreamHack make it a favored choice for competitive players. Epic Games has also entered the esports scene with impressive support for Fortnite tournaments, offering substantial prize pools and creative competitions that engage the community.

Community and Social Interaction

Community interaction plays a crucial role in esports, and both platforms excel in different ways. Steam provides an extensive community hub where players can discuss strategies, share content, and form teams. Epic Games, however, emphasizes social connectivity, allowing players to easily invite friends and join matches, which enhances the collaborative experience in competitive gameplay.

The Verdict: Which Platform Reigns Supreme?

Ultimately, the choice between Steam and Epic Games boils down to personal preference. If you value a vast game library and rich community features, Steam may be your best bet. Conversely, if you’re drawn to exclusive titles and a user-friendly interface, Epic Games might be the platform to choose.
